    Uncertainty shrouds Gasol's future with Lakers (Reuters)

    (Reuters) - Pau Gasol expressed uncertainty about his future with the Los Angeles Lakers after his postseason exit interview with general manager Mitch Kupchak at the team's training facility on Wednesday. The Lakers were eliminated from the Western Conference semi-finals by the Oklahoma City Thunder on Monday after an erratic playoff run during which Gasol was accused by team mate Kobe Bryant of not displaying enough aggression. ...

    The Denver Nuggets? Gone till November (Ball Don't Lie)

    After years of turnover, the Denver Nuggets you saw in 2011-12 might closely resemble the ones you'll see in 2012-13. We'll determine whether or not this is a good thing in the fall, when it comes time to dissect the team's standing amongst the best of the West, but for now all signs point to a similarly stout roster in 2012-13, full of the depth and balance that pushed a championship-contending Lakers team to the brink in seven tough games. Or, Denver could blow it up. Which wouldn't be a sign of the team losing its nerve, but it wouldn't be surprising. After all, Nuggets GM Masai Ujiri is the same guy that signed center Nene to a franchise-level contract in December, only to deal him four months later; and not because Nene was playing terribly. This is a man who isn't afraid to think on his feet, and considering the team's numerous tradeable assets, the Nuggets would seem to be in prime position to make a move for a star of sorts, considering the team's recent run of star-less play. Of course, the Nuggets have been in that position for over a year now. Houston Rockets GM Daryl Morey, one of the more proactive personnel chiefs in the game, has been in that position for a while, unable (though he's tried) to pull the trigger despite a heap of players that other teams want. There's no given, out there, and fewer stars on the block to go after. So it appears that the team might stick with that depth, and that hero-every-other-game philosophy. Sounds good to us.
